‘Second marriage for not bearing son!’ Odisha Woman assaults husband in court over ‘second marriage’

PUBLISHED: LAST UPDATE:

Bandana Mallick assaulted her husband Kishore at Pattamundai Court for attempting a second marriage, alleging harassment over not bearing a son; police intervened and she protested.

Woman assaults husband in court over ‘second marriage’

A dramatic confrontation broke out at Pattamundai Court in Odisha when a woman assaulted her husband for allegedly attempting to solemnise a second marriage. The man, identified as Kishore Mallick of Tunupur village, is reportedly married to Bandana Mallick and is the father of four daughters.

Wife Confronts Husband in Court Premises

According to reports, Kishore had arrived at the court to contract a second marriage. On receiving this information, Bandana rushed to the spot and confronted him. In full public view, she physically assaulted Kishore, sparking chaos in the courtroom compound and drawing the attention of bystanders.

Wife’s Allegations

Speaking to the media, Bandana alleged that her in-laws and husband had continuously harassed her for not bearing a son. “My mother-in-law says they want a son, not a girl, and my husband also supports this. They tortured me and forced me out of the house. My husband said he would marry her through a court marriage. When I got to know, I came with my family and caught them,” she said.

Husband Denies Second Marriage

Kishore, however, denied the allegations, insisting that no marriage had taken place. “I haven’t married anyone. They entered my house and dragged me with 10 to 12 people and thrashed me. She is my sister, and I have an FIR stating she is my sister,” Kishore claimed.

Police Intervention and Protest

Police reached the scene and took Kishore to the local station for his safety. Meanwhile, Bandana staged a sit-in protest outside the court premises, demanding justice and action against her husband.
